Illustrate the intervals in mathematics
Carrier set of a Range of T is the set of all sets of values v ∈ T such that for some start value s ∈ T and end value e ∈ T, either s ≤ v and v ≤ e (the inclusive ranges), or s ≤ v and v < s (the exclusive ranges), plus empty set. For instance, carrier set of the Range of Integer is the set of all sequences of contiguous integers. Carrier set of the Range of Real is the set of all sets of real number greater than or equal to a given number and either less than or equal to another, or less than another. These sets are known as intervals in mathematics.
